Impex "Mystic"
The Mystic was
designed for smaller paddlers who still want big sea kayak performance. At 14'
long and 21.5" wide it is a perfectly downsized sea kayak. It is outfitted with
a round rubber hatch in the front, and an oval rubber hatch in the rear, giving
this boat great overnight appeal. Everything is kept dry and rigid with 2
fiberglass concave bulkheads. A retractable skeg is standard for the days when
the weather just won't cooperate. Built with the Impex philosophy of greater
initial stability, this boat gives a very comfortable ride without sacrificing
performance. Match this perfect sized boat to your body and ability and watch
as you lead the pack of over sized kayaks and over worked paddlers.
Length- 14 feet Width- 21.5
inches Mid-ship height- 11 inches Cockpit size (inside) 16x30
inches Weight- Standard Glass- 43 pounds Suggested Paddler Weight-
90-180 pounds.

Hull
Design- Shallow V. Primary stability is the key to comfortable
paddling, whether slowing down to relax and take in the sights or coming out of
a protected bay into the wind and swells. Although the Pro Tour series has a
narrower beam to increase responsiveness, our standard shallow V hull gives
paddlers more primary stability. This gives paddlers the ability to push their
limits with confidence and comfort no matter what their skill level.
Rocker- All Greenland style kayaks will have
increased rocker, this is what gives these boats the versatility that makes
them special. However the Pro Tour Series drops the rocker out to a minimal
level. Still allowing for comfort and control in large waves and tight rocky
shorelines, but with the maximum focus on efficiency and speed for long
distance touring. Although it may take more edge control to make these kayaks
turn, the compromise pays dividends at the end of the longest paddling
days.
Aggressive Medium.
Impex Kayaks tries out some new terminology. A Medium Chine allows the kayak to
have excellent secondary stability while edging the kayak, maintaining the
comfort and stability that we all demand. This design allows the paddler to
edge the boat confidently to obtain a fast turn, without the potential of
tripping over hard chines, especially in bigger water and high winds. With the
lower rocker profile of the Pro Tour Series, to increase efficiency, we needed
to be creative to keep the kayak maneuverable and solid on edge in the rough
conditions it was designed for. Hence, the Aggressive Medium. Harder than what
we use on out Performance Tour Line, this design allows for more bite on the
water for tighter turns. This along with the narrower beam does wonders to get
this flatter rockered 18 footer coming around more quickly and gliding
gracefully down wave faces. The chine is however not a true hard chine, keeping
water flowing smoothly and keeping the kayak more stable on edge, especially in
beam seas.

Impex "Outer Island"
We are proud to introduce for the first time in composite lay up,
the Outer Island. Designed in 1995, by paddler designer Jay Babina, with
performance, rolling ability, low windage and speed as the main criteria. At 18
feet long, only 21 inches wide and with very little hull rocker, it has loads
of speed for touring. Its low rear deck makes her a perfect fit for the
beginner to advanced Eskimo roller. Soft chines allow for graceful control
between steady primary and secondary stability. Allowing for increased success
even when perfecting the most challenging of Greenland rolls and braces.
Whether you love this kayak for its sheer elegance, a fast touring kayak or a
rolling machine, we promise you will love it.
Length- 18 feet Width- 21.5
inches Mid-ship height- 10 inches Rear Deck height- 7 inches
Cockpit size (inside) 16x30 inches Weight- Standard Glass- 55
pounds
 |
Overall Volume- 58 US gallons Front Storage- 2500
cubic inches Day Hatch- 1580 cubic inches Rear Hatch- 2900 cubic inches
Shallow V.The shallow
V hull is standard in all Impex Kayaks and it is this design that allows for
the greater primary stability in our kayaks. We have found an excellent
compromise between stability and performance that allows our kayaks to appeal
to all ends of the ability spectrum.
Rocker- the flatter rocker of the Outer Island is what
gives this kayak its amazing hull speed. Harder to turn in the tight spots due
to the stiffer hull, it is certainly a compromise. However as your skills grow
the Outer Island comes around with grace and you can never say enough about the
speed.
Soft. A Soft Chine, while
still giving excellent stability on edge, allows for smooth transition from
primary to secondary stability. It is this trait that allows for this kayak to
be such an easy kayak in which to practice and master even the hardest
traditional Greenland braces and rolls.

Hull Design-
- Shallow V.
The shallow V hull is standard in all Impex Kayaks and it is this design that allows for the greater primary stability in our kayaks. We have found an excellent compromise between stability and performance that allows our kayaks to appeal to all ends of the ability spectrum.
- Chine-
using a multi hard chine we pick up the stability we lose by giving the Irie a shallow V in the hull. Everyone knows the most stable of boats, like a Jon Boat, use flat hulls. The problem there is that we donšt intend on putting a motor behind our kayak to propel it, we plan on doing that with a paddle. The Shallow V gives a kayak the best stability while maintaining efficient paddling, let is still not as stable as a flat bottom. By adding the stability of the multi chine we now have a great combination of stability and efficient paddling.

Impex "Temiskawa" |
 |
"The more the merrier" Who ever came up with this famous quote was certainly onto something. There is something to be said for being able to share with friends, family and loved ones something we are so passionate about. Like the rest of our line we have come up with an easier to paddle and handle double. There are several great expedition doubles out there, so why try and clutter things with another version. Short, narrower and certainly lightweight, the Temiskawa allows more people to enjoy the benefits of Tandem paddling on a less than expedition size trip. By no means turning our backs entirely on tripping, we do offer over 9000 cubic inches of storage capacity, however we feel the 86-pound weight and short 19 feet 8 inches will be the stats that appeal to our customers. Although shorter, at only 25.5 inches wide there is an efficient water line that moves along well and keeps its hull speed even with paddlers of different strengths and during alternating paddler rests. As in most doubles the length and width make it difficult to turn with leaning and paddle strokes. To accommodate easier maneuverability we use the benefit of a foot controlled rudder system, for easier paddling. Impex Kayaks has worked hard to create a unique line of kayaks, we feel the Temiskawa is a great fit for those who don't see the need for alone time. |
